> Now, the funny thing is this actually works; process 238 will be killed if
> I hit return. But how do I get rid of the error message?
compctl -j -P '%' + -s '`ps x | tail +2 | cut -c1-5`' + \
-x 's[-] p[1]' -k "($signals[1,-3])" -- kill
